[QUOTE="backhoeboogie, post: 255250, member: 3162"] My bull got into something. Cactus, mesquite thorns, or whatever. He swole up the size of a coffee can. It was pretty disheartening. At the time, he wasn't going to be needed for another 4 months or so. He was capable of relieving himself so I let him go. I couldn't see anything broken. I crossed my fingers! A vet was out about 2 months later so I put him in the head chute and let the vet take a look, just in case something was wrong. The vet gave him a clean bill of health. Nothing damaged, nothing broken. It was a relief. [/QUOTE]
